Gas/Propane Heaters
The document has two positions regarding appliance selection. These include that appliances without oxygen depletion
sensors (ODS) should not be used and that any appliance that
is used should be listed to ANSI Standard Z21.11.2. There
are three research needs identified, which could inform future positions. These include evaluating the suitability of the
nitrogen dioxide thresholds in the ANSI appliance standard;
measuring the nitrogen dioxide levels in homes using units
manufactured since 2005 when the nitrogen dioxide emissions requirements went into enforcement; and measuring
particle emissions.
Kerosene/Denatured Alcohol Appliances
Due to the lack of research information available, the position
document simply states that any kerosene or denatured alcohol

appliances should be listed to the relevant standard (UL 647
for kerosene, UL 1370 for denatured alcohol), and that further
installations should be avoided until such time as research
demonstrates the safety of these appliances.
Standards
There are three positions taken with regard to standards.
One is that appliance standards should be reviewed in light
of recently published standards on nitrogen dioxide, most
prominently the new EPA standard for outdoor air. The second
is that heating appliance standards should be reviewed regarding carbon monoxide in light of evidence in field research that
extended continuous use (one hour or more) is not uncommon.
The third is that ventilation standards should include unvented
combustion in their scopes and set appropriate requirements.
This has led to a change proposal in ASHRAE Standard 62.2
to include unvented combustion in the scope; this proposal is
currently working its way through the public review process.
Public Awareness
The document takes two positions with regard to public
awareness. One is that a public education program should be
developed to reinforce the information regarding health and
safety in industry literature. The second is that those who wish
to minimize the risk of adverse health effects due to combustion products should not use unvented combustion appliances.

Summary
ASHRAE’s position document on unvented combustion and
IAQ covers a range of issues and appliance types. It is based
on those research results that are available and identifies gaps
in the knowledge base. It takes meaningful positions based on
the current knowledge regarding potential improvements in
appliance standards and recommendations as well as ventilation standards. While it is not expected that this position document will settle the debate on these appliances, it is a valuable
resource regarding what is known about these appliances and
what measures should be taken to minimize the risk from exposure to combustion products. The position document can be
